[PATCH 13/18] gpu: nova-core: register: use #[inline(always)] for all methods
Alexandre Courbot
acourbot at nvidia.com
Fri Jul 4 07:25:14 UTC 2025
These methods should always be inlined, so use the strongest compiler
hint that exists to maximize the chance they will indeed be.
